Eurocopter AS355 vs Eurocopter H125
The Eurocopter AS355 (Twin Squirrel) and H125 (single Squirrel/AStar) share the Squirrel airframe — the AS355 has two engines for twin-engine redundancy and over-city/over-water reassurance; the H125 is the more powerful, more economical single.

Which Should You Buy: Eurocopter AS355 or Eurocopter H125?
Bottom line: Choose the H125 for more lift, hot-and-high performance and lower operating cost in the single-engine role. Choose the AS355 when twin-engine redundancy is required (over-water, over-city, certain EMS/charter rules) — accepting higher fuel and maintenance cost for the second engine.
